This tests the conversion of libvirt XML to libxl_domain_config
objects by the libvirt libxl driver.

Changed in v2:

 - Compare the parsed JSON object model instead of strcmp() on
   the string-ified JSON document

 - To cope with new additions between Xen 4.3 and 4.4

    - Ignore case where actual JSON object has gained new keys.
      This copes with fact that '/c_info' gained a new key
      called 'pvh' in 4.4

    - Ignore case where actual JSON value has changed from 'null'
      to a non-'null' value type. This copes with fact that
      the element at /b_info/device_model_version changed from 
      'null' to a specific value by default in 4.4.

 - Use libxl_domain_config_to_json instead of libxl_json.h
   functions, and disable test if running on Xen version
   which lacks this function (eg 4.2)

 - Isolate VNC port allocator from host TCP ports so a predictable
   VNC port is always in the config.

Daniel P. Berrange (4):
  util: Introduce virJSONStringCompare for JSON doc comparisons
  util: Allow port allocator to skip bind() check
  tests: Add more test suite mock helpers
  libxl: Add a test suite for libxl option generator
